EDUC 285E: SECONDARY SOCIAL STUDIES
University of California, Riverside
4 Units, Seminar, 3 hours; research, 3 hours. Prerequisite(s): EDUC 147 with a grade of C- or better; EDUC 162 with a grade of C- or better or EDUC 280L with a grade of C- or better; EDUC 132 with a grade of C- or better; EDUC 177 with a grade of C- or better, may be taken concurrently or EDUC 178 with a grade of C- or better, may be taken concurrently; admission to a teaching credential program; graduate standing; or consent of instructor. Introduces curriculum theory and instructional processes as they relate to the single subject classroom. E. Secondary Social Studies; I. Secondary English; L. Secondary Foreign Language; M. Secondary Mathematics; N. Secondary Mathematics And Science; R. Secondary Visual And Performing Arts; S. Secondary Science; T. Portraits Of Teaching.
